Navigating Legal Steps After an Assault

Navigating the legal process after a sexual assault is an essential step toward justice and healing for victims in Indiana. This journey can be daunting, filled with complex procedures and emotional challenges. Many survivors may feel overwhelmed, making it crucial to seek guidance from legal experts specialized in these cases. A sexual assault lawyer Indiana offers invaluable support, ensuring victims’ rights are protected throughout the entire process.
The immediate steps after an assault involve reporting the crime to local law enforcement. This triggers the initiation of a criminal investigation, where evidence collection and witness interviews take center stage. Simultaneously, survivors should consider consulting a civil litigation attorney who can explain their legal options for civil suits against the perpetrator or institutions responsible. Unlike criminal proceedings focused on punishment, civil lawsuits aim to provide compensation for emotional distress, medical expenses, and other damages suffered as a result of the assault.
